So, @kissane and I have formally kicked off our Fediverse research project! Briefly, we are doing interviews with admin/mod teams about governance models and practices that are in place on servers with ~150-2500 active users. More info is available here on the project blog:
https://write.as/fediversalist-papers/kicking-off-our-fediverse-research
The blog hosted at write.as which means you can follow it at @fediversalist-papers, or via RSS, or via email (there's a form on the bottom of the main blog page).
